A client's diagnosis of pneumonia requires treatment with antibiotics. The corresponding order in the client's chart should be written as ...
 
  A) Avelox (moxifloxacin) 400 mg daily
  B) Avelox (moxifloxacin) 400 mg Q.D.
  C) Avelox (moxifloxacin) 400 mg qd
  D) Avelox (moxifloxacin) 400 mg OD

Answer to Question 1

Ans: A

Among the JCAHO's list of do not use abbreviations are Q.D., qd, and OD when denoting a once-per-day drug administration. Because of the potential for misinterpretation and consequent drug errors, the JCAHO recommends writing daily in the order.

Many people have small pouches in their colons that bulge outward through weak spots. Each pouch is called a diverticulum. About 10% of Americans older than age 40 years have diverticulosis, which, when the pouches become infected or inflamed, is called diverticulitis. The main cause of diverticular disease is a low-fiber diet.
